We are looking for a Head of Decision Science to join our Decision Science team within Risk. The Risk team plays a crucial role in Funding Circle. They ensure our borrowers and investors get what we promise, use data and modelling to provide insights to the rest of the business, control and monitor the risk within our processes ensuring that we always deliver and they help us make data driven decisions to guide our strategy.
Funding Circle’s Decision Science team is hugely influential to our overall lending process. They build statistical models and use advanced quantitative techniques to enable many different teams across the organisation to optimise business and lending strategies.

The role:
- Report to the Chief Credit Officer, advising on the use of statistical models and advanced quantitative techniques to optimise business performance.
- Working across our UK business, you will collaborate with experts in risk management, technology, data management, marketing, business operations to understand business needs and shape analytical solutions.
- Managing a team of data scientists you will be responsible for designing, developing and implementing complex statistical models used for marketing targeting, credit underwriting, fraud prevention, collections, recoveries and customer experience.
- You will ensure decision models are very reliable, through thorough validation and testing. You will champion best practices in model building and help shape quality standards. You will monitor model performance, identify issues and implement fixes.
- You will research new data sources and new modelling techniques, helping Funding Circle identify next analytical innovations.
